This one has everything I love about Chinese period dramas

The main couple embodies both the "Wattpad bad boy" toxic dynamic and the "stealing glimpses of your high school crush" butterflies-in-the-stomach feeling.

Both of the leads are toxic, scheming their own games, neither radiating sincerity at first. The goodness in their layered characters appears gradually. The ML is an actual red flag, but only during his mental episodes. This adds an exciting layer to their relationship, as we get the thrill of a bad boy romance minus the guilt, since he’s not himself when he’s being a monster. But then again, maybe he’s just unleashing his true, unrestrained self, only other times he’s holding back.

The male lead’s innocent crush—secretly studying her face, stealing shy glances, making lame excuses just to be around her—absolutely heart-fluttering. These lighthearted, fun moments gradually evolve into a deep, passionate love over time. The transition was seamless, and how they embraced their feelings and built trust between each other happened at the perfect pace.
The drama explores many themes: palace politics, revenge, toxic relationships, and fluffy romance, with each arc being captivating and well-balanced. Definitely a must watch and became my favorite cdrama so far!
